🖨️ How to Prepare the Sentence Scramble Activity

Prepare the Sentence-Building Cards

Print the sentence cards on cardstock and laminate them for repeated use. Cut around each card and store the numbered sentence sets in separate envelopes, bags or containers.

Prepare the Cut-and-Paste Worksheets

Print the worksheet version that best suits each student’s needs. The independent worksheets provide a greater challenge, while the supported worksheets include a completed model sentence for emerging readers and writers.

🏫 How to Use the Sentence Scramble Worksheets

Whole-Class Sentence Building

Display the cards in a pocket chart and model how to arrange the words in the correct order. Read the completed sentence together and identify its capital letter and punctuation mark.

Small-Group Literacy Instruction

Guide students as they build and read each sentence. Encourage them to use the picture cards, sentence meaning and punctuation to check their work.

Literacy or Writing Centers

Place the numbered card sets and corresponding worksheets in a center. Students can build each sentence with the cards before completing the matching cut-and-paste worksheet.

Independent Sentence Practice

Use the worksheets without model sentences when students are ready to arrange and write complete sentences more independently.

Support for Emerging Writers

Provide the simplified worksheets so students can refer to the completed model sentence while arranging, reading and writing the words.

Informal Assessment

Observe whether students can arrange words in a meaningful order, identify sentence punctuation and copy the completed sentence accurately.
